MacBook Neo now available for pre-order, starts at $599

Apple has just unveiled its new, budget-friendly MacBook Neo. And you can pre-order the new model now, starting at $599.

The latest addition to the Mac family is here.

MacBook Neo was introduced today, and is on the Apple Store.

Currently, the earliest delivery times for MacBook Neo are next Wednesday, March 11.

The new low-cost MacBook starts at $599, but education customers can buy it for a discounted price of $499.

That $599 entry model comes with 256GB of storage and no Touch ID support.

There’s also a $699 model that includes double the storage—512GB—and adds Touch ID.

MacBook Neo is available in four colors: silver, blush, citrus, and indigo.
